Survival Guide: Zombie

"Survival Guide of a Zombie" follows the story of Ryder, a man who wakes up one day to find himself turned into a zombie. With his newfound abilities, Ryder navigates a post-apocalyptic world filled with danger and uncertainty. Along the way, he faces challenges both physical and emotional, as he struggles to come to terms with his new existence and find a way to survive. With his father's words of wisdom echoing in his mind, Ryder sets out on a mission to take down every zombie he sees, fueled by his desire for revenge and the hope that he can still make a difference in a world that has been turned upside down.

First Mission

The First mission assigned to ZUE3 is to search and destroy underground lab #21. The World Zombie Control Department (WZCD) assigned this mission to observe the powers of the superhuman personnel and to check if they are useful or not. As the squad leader, Lawrence explained the mission to his teammates and assigned each member their role.

The mission required the team to explore the underground lab, search for any possible document containing valuable information, get samples of any ongoing experiments, and then destroy the lab without leaving any trace. The team understood their roles and began preparing the necessary equipment for their first mission. Meanwhile, Vincent would observe them using a drone during the mission.

This mission would be crucial for ZUE3 to prove their worth to the WZCD. The success of this mission could determine the future of the team and their role in the fight against the zombies. The team was aware of the importance of their mission and how it would reflect on their abilities and usefulness.

The mission also posed a great risk to the team. Underground lab #21 could have various obstacles and dangers that could put the team's lives in jeopardy. However, with their powers and skills, the team was confident in their ability to successfully complete the mission.

The anticipation of the mission created a sense of excitement and fear among the team. They were aware that their success could determine their future, and they were determined to succeed. As they prepared for their mission, they focused on their roles and responsibilities, ready to face any obstacle that would come their way.
